01' Escape misfiring?
I've got an 01' Escape, v6 and Monday morning the CEL was blinking and car was surging noticably (meaning misfiring) so after work I pulled the codes and it read P0304 (cylinder 4 misfire).
I recently had to replace 3 of the coilpacks so that's what I checked first. I swapped 4 and 5 and it still read 4 was bad, so not the coilpack... Pulled the plugs (not even 4,000 miles on them) and they still look great.
After the inital morning of the CEL blinking and car surging, the light has remained steady, but do not notice anything out of the ordinary (no noises, surging, etc). I drove the 30 mins to work hoping it would clear the light, but no.
I guess i'm look for sugestions from here. I've babied it since the light came on, and have avoided driving it, am I causing damage? Should I try clearing the light? I'm supposed to head across state this weekend (~300 mi round trip) do I dare or really get this thing fixed? I suppose it could be the wires, can you easily swap those to see if thats the case?
Thanks for any help!

RE: 01' Escape misfiring?
When the CEL flashes (once per second), itindicates that a misfire is detected 'severe enough' to cause catalyst damage. If the CEL is on steadyfrom a misfire, it'sindicating the threshold for emissions has been exceeded.. If you swapped the COP, that should have included the boot/connection and if bad, should have followed the swap as well.. Which of the initial 3 did you replace? If an injectorhangs,and allows for any unmetered fuel drop, it can cause a surge and/or misfire and flash the CEL.. Or a bad injector/connection can cause a misfire.. You might try clearing the CEL, and driving the vehicle to complete the diagnostic monitors and see if the light resets.. Generally it'll take an extended 'driving strategy' to be met/completed for themonitors to test, usaully a few days or so depending on the miles drive, and conditions met..
